- ## TLS ##
-
- # PEM-encoded X509 certificate for TLS.
- # This certificate, as of Synapse 1.0, will need to be a valid and verifiable
- # certificate, signed by a recognised Certificate Authority.
- #
- # Be sure to use a `.pem` file that includes the full certificate chain including
- # any intermediate certificates (for instance, if using certbot, use
- # `fullchain.pem` as your certificate, not `cert.pem`).
- #
- %(tls_enabled)stls_certificate_path: "%(tls_certificate_path)s"
-
- # PEM-encoded private key for TLS
- #
- %(tls_enabled)stls_private_key_path: "%(tls_private_key_path)s"
-
- # Whether to verify TLS server certificates for outbound federation requests.
- #
- # Defaults to `true`. To disable certificate verification, uncomment the
- # following line.
- #
- #federation_verify_certificates: false
-
- # The minimum TLS version that will be used for outbound federation requests.
- #
- # Defaults to `1`. Configurable to `1`, `1.1`, `1.2`, or `1.3`. Note
- # that setting this value higher than `1.2` will prevent federation to most
- # of the public Matrix network: only configure it to `1.3` if you have an
- # entirely private federation setup and you can ensure TLS 1.3 support.
- #
- #federation_client_minimum_tls_version: 1.2
-
- # Skip federation certificate verification on the following whitelist
- # of domains.
- #
- # This setting should only be used in very specific cases, such as
- # federation over Tor hidden services and similar. For private networks
- # of homeservers, you likely want to use a private CA instead.
- #
- # Only effective if federation_verify_certicates is `true`.
- #
- #federation_certificate_verification_whitelist:
- # - lon.example.com
- # - "*.domain.com"
- # - "*.onion"
-
- # List of custom certificate authorities for federation traffic.
- #
- # This setting should only normally be used within a private network of
- # homeservers.
- #
- # Note that this list will replace those that are provided by your
- # operating environment. Certificates must be in PEM format.
- #
- #federation_custom_ca_list:
- # - myCA1.pem
- # - myCA2.pem
- # - myCA3.pem
- """
